All changes to the Quillstone rendering core require approval before inclusion in a release cut. This covers cache invalidation logic, partial compilation, and any modification to the hot-path interpolation loop. Benchmarks must be attached showing p95 render latency under 40ms on the standard Fernvale corpus. The release manager should block promotion if benchmark artifacts are missing or stale. Escalations for waived benchmarks go through a single approver. Sign-off authority for this page rests with the following engineer.

account owner for bawip-tahag: Raleth Quenok

## Kiosk watchdog — restart procedure

If the Lumabox kiosk watchdog stops reporting, restart `lumawatch.service` and check `/var/log/lumawatch`. Three consecutive failures trigger a full kiosk reboot. The watchdog phones home to the Fleetpulse monitor every 30 seconds and authenticates via the env file. The monitor auth secret sits on the next line.

vault entry, kafog-yahop: COURIER_KEY8=0faa53ae

Office Closure — Ashgrove Site (Managers Only)

The Ashgrove satellite office will close at quarter-end. Finance should accrue lease termination fees, reconcile petty cash, and reclassify the six remaining assets to the Fernvale hub. Staff transfers are handled separately by People Ops; do not process severance entries yet. Rationale and forward planning are captured in the confidential note appended below.

confidential, kagup-bafog: Fraaxax Group is in early talks to buy Soroxox Group for about $343.8 million. The Olidor launch date is June 14, and nothing goes to the press before then. Legal wants the Aldmirek Logistics term sheet signed before July 23.

## Ticket: Zero-downtime schema migration for the Ledgerleaf orders table

We plan to split the `orders` table using the expand-contract pattern: add new columns, dual-write from the application, backfill in batches of 5k rows, verify parity, then drop the legacy columns in a later release. No locks longer than 500ms are expected; the backfill runs throttled off-peak. Rollback is a config flag that reverts to legacy writes. Per release policy, this migration cannot ship without a named sign-off, recorded below.

signatory, kafop-bahaf: Lamion Queniel Jorir Olidor